What does the green dot mean on my text messages Android?

Since Android 12 (S OS), Samsung has included several enhancements to improve the user privacy protection experience. This green dot is a tool that allows you to know when an application is accessing the device's camera or microphone in real time by displaying a green dot at the top of the notification panel.

Why is there a dot next to some of my contacts?

The messages app scans your contacts and connects to your your carrier database and determines how many of your contacts are using RCS capable phones and their RCS network infrastructure. It marks the contacts with a blue dot if they have met the requirements for sending and receiving messages in chat mode.

What is the dot symbol in Android phone?

The tiny dots visible at the top of the screen are Privacy Indicators aimed to alert users about apps using camera, mic, location and more on your phone's hardware without you noticing. Google launched the Android 12 mobile operating system last year.

What is chat mode on Samsung?

RCS, also known as Chat, is an enhanced messaging experience on Android devices that is an upgrade to simple text/SMS and is similar to iMessage or WhatsApp. Chat is enabled by Google's Android platform and is accessible using either Google's Android Messages app or Samsung's Messages app.

What happens to text messages when you block someone on Android?

Android phones move all blocked messages into a folder on the phone called “Spam and Blocked.” That means that the phone is still collecting messages from the blocked people; they just aren't notifying you.
